thanks,they are housing benefit tenants, the housing benefit is paid direct because of the arrears, this has now been stopped because his circumstances have changed.
the tenacy agreement states rent due monthly, i have provided a statement to the tenant showing the arrears .
If Letting Agreement demands rent monthly in advance (which is almost always the case), that's what T is obliged to pay; HB dates are irrelevant.
Forget 'twelve weeks'. Does T owe at least two months' rent? If so, serve s.8 Notice (grounds 8/10/11). Two weeks later, begin proceedings.
